2. K-line Experience on the Mini

The 8.3-inch screen provides 50% more display area than a 6.1-inch phone. It can simultaneously show the order book + K-line chart + positions + open orders in four sections, eliminating the need to constantly switch pages.

Futures page landscape layout:

  • Left: Order book (Market depth)
  • Center: K-line chart + Indicators
  • Right: Order placement panel
  • Bottom: Positions and open orders

The four sections do not overlap or squeeze each other, making technical analysis a breeze.

4. KYC Photo Experience

The mini's front-facing camera is located in the middle of the long edge (slightly to the left in landscape mode), so the face position might be slightly skewed during liveness detection. Recommendations:

  • Taking document photos: Use the mini's rear camera for ID cards or passports
  • Liveness detection: Using an iPhone is recommended (front camera is perfectly centered)
  • Process compatibility: Completing the entire KYC process on the mini is fine, but the experience is slightly inferior to the iPhone

5. Battery Life and Trading Stability

The mini generally lasts 3-4 days on a single charge (with moderate use). Keeping the Binance APP connected in the background:

  • At full charge, a single APP in the background drains about 5-8% a day
  • Watching the market with the screen on for extended periods will drain the battery quickly (about 8-10% per hour with the screen on)
  • For frequent travelers, a PD fast-charging power bank is recommended

6. Security Features

The mini is equipped with Touch ID (on the top edge power button). The response speed is slightly slower than Face ID, but unlocking is stable.

All Face ID features of the Binance APP automatically switch to Touch ID on the mini:

  • APP startup lock
  • Withdrawal confirmation
  • Trusted device login

The overall effect and security are consistent with the iPhone.

7. Apple Pencil as a Bonus

The mini 6 / mini 7 supports Apple Pencil 2 / Pencil USB-C. Drawing support/resistance lines on the K-line chart is extremely convenient.

The Binance APP's drawing tools respond well to Pencil input, offering higher drawing precision than a finger. Technical analysis enthusiasts will find this to be a significant bonus.

FAQ

Q1: Should I use my iPad ID or iPhone ID to install Binance on the mini? Just use the same non-US/HK Apple ID. It is independent of the device type.

Q2: Which model is recommended: mini 5, 6, or 7? The mini 6 or newer (A15 chip or above) is recommended for running Binance smoothly. The mini 5 is a bit outdated.

Q3: How do I connect a YubiKey to the mini? Starting from the mini 6, it uses a USB-C port, so you can directly plug in a YubiKey 5C NFC.

Q4: Is the mini suitable as a primary trading device? It is fine for light trading. For heavy trading, a larger iPad or a desktop setup is still recommended.
